How to Help your Child “Reset”: Co-parenting strategies to soften the stress of Transition Days
Transition days, those handoff moments when your child returns from the other parent’s house, can be tender, unpredictable, and sometimes downright difficult. Whether your child comes back shut down, hyperactive, clingy, distant, or “off,” it can leave you feeling helpless, frustrated, or rejected.
But here's the truth: your child isn't being difficult. They're adapting. With a little intention and compassion, you can help them reset! This post will walk you through some strategies!

Anxious Thoughts: How Conscious Reframing Can Be a Game Changer
Anxious thoughts can feel automatic, intrusive, and all too real. But here’s the truth: just because a thought feels true doesn’t mean it is. In fact, many of our most anxiety-inducing thoughts are simply mental habits (patterns we’ve repeated so often that they feel like facts).
The good news? You can change them.

You Want to Forgive… But You Can’t Seem to Move On (and that doesn't mean you're failing)
You’ve told yourself,“I want to forgive.”You’ve tried to let go.You’ve journaled, meditated, maybe even had the hard conversations. They have made efforts to make amends and now the ball is in your court.
And still—something lingers. A heaviness. A sting. A part of you that just… can’t seem to move on.
Let’s talk about that. Because forgiveness is not a light switch.It’s not a moment. It’s a process—and sometimes, it’s a long one.
